What is Wage War’s most popular song?
Determining Wage War’s most popular song can depend on the metric. Some of their most streamed songs include “Stitch,” “Low,” and “High Horse.”
What other bands are similar to Wage War?
Fans of Wage War may also enjoy bands such as The Ghost Inside, Architects, and Fit For A King.
When did Wage War form?
Wage War formed in 2010 in Ocala, Florida.
